Bonding Flashcards
Define covalent bonding fully
When two positive nuclei are held together by their common attraction for a shared pair of electrons and are both non metal
What are the four different shapes of molecules
Linear ,angular ,trigonal pyramidal ,tetrahedral
What is the properties of a covalent molecular structure
Low melting and boiling point due to the forces of attraction between molecules being weak ( inter molecular forces)
What is a giant lattice structure
A covalent network with many covalent bonds creating one giant structure which is very hard to break

Define di atomic molecules
Molecules that contain only two atoms
7 di atomic molecules
Hydrogen H2, Nitrogen N2, fluorine F2, oxygen O2, Iodine I2, chlorine cl2, Bromine Br2

What can covalent substances form
Small discrete molecules (4 shapes ) or giant structures (lattice structures )
Covalent molecular substances have
Strong bonds -within- the molecule bit weak inter molecular forces between molecules.
Low melting and boiling points due to weak inter molecular forces between molecules. Don’t conduct electricity because don’t have charged particles which are free to move.

Fully explain covalent structures
Have a network of strong covalent bonds. Has very high melting and boiling point because network of covalent bonds hard to break. Do not dissolve.
Do covalent structures conduct
Do not conduct due to mot having changed particles which are free to move
How are ions formed
When atoms gain or loose and electron to become stable and have full outer shell
What happens to metal atoms
Lose electrons to form positive ions
What happens to non metal atoms
Gain electron to form negative ions

What are ionic bonds
The electrostatic attraction between positive and negative ions
